FAQs
Which trip is best for my group?
For families with kids under 5 or those looking for a mellow float, the Short & Mild trip will be the perfect option.
The half-day and full-day trips are the best options for groups with a range of ability levels - they're exciting enough to keep experienced rafters entertained, but not too intimidating for first-timers. Opt for the full-day for maximum river time, and a riverside lunch.
The Double Shoshone trips are the most exciting option - perfect for bachelor or bachelorette parties who want maximum whitewater and high adventure!

Do I need to wear a wetsuit?
During May and most of June many of our guests will raft in our wetsuit outfits. From mid-June onward in the season most guests will raft in shorts and T-shirts. Hats, sunscreen, a water bottle and shoes that would stay on in the event of a swim are always good ideas. Heavy cotton like jeans or sweaters perform poorly and are not recommended.

What is the best time of day to raft?
We have almost limitless sunny days here in Glenwood Springs. Typical in-season daytime highs are in the 80s. Our afternoon trips may see an occasional thundershower, but normally a break from the heat and sun is welcome. Our noon and 1pm launch times are the most popular.
For those rare rainy days we provide rain gear and have full wetsuits available for anyone who may tend to chill easily. We guarantee our trip departure so come rain or shine, we go out regardless. However, you have the right to cancel or change your trip due to inclement weather, 24 hours prior to the trip departure, with no penalty.
